Emphasizing the low end (only
available from the remote
controller)
Press S.BASS.
Pressing the button repeatedly will
change the indication as follows.
The higher numbers emphasize the
low end.
Adjusting the tone
Muting the sound (only available
from the remote controller)
Press MUTING on the remote controller. The
MUTING indicator lights in the display.
To restore the sound, press MUTING again.
Tip
During muting:
If you press VOLUME
/ on the remote controller, the
sound will be restored.
If you turn the unit off and then on again, the sound will be
restored.
Listening through the headphones
Decrease the volume, then connect the stereo
headphones mini plug to the PHONES jack.
You can adjust the volume and mute the sound as
described above.
The speakers will reproduce no sound while the
headphones are connected.
